Chimpers, a popular Ethereum-based NFT project, has announced the launch of its first physical product in a collaboration with IP incubator 223. The partnership introduces a “plush keychain blind box” collection, featuring Chimpers characters and tying physical ownership to digital experiences.
The Series 1 collectible will only be available through 223’s digital marketplace at launch, according to the company, though plans are in place to expand into retail later. Chimpers has built a social media following of more than 1.8 million, with the goal of creating greater fan engagement. “We’ve built a following of over 1.8 million, but the real goal is turning fans into believers. That shift happens when people can hold a piece of the Chimpverse in their hands,” said Jacob Timperley, co-founder of Chimpers.
Timperley credited 223 with bringing real-world connections to the Chimpers brand. “223’s experience and network will bring the Chimpverse to life in a whole new way and allow the Chimpverse to grow, inviting new audiences to discover and engage with us,” he stated. The plush keychains are distributed in blind boxes—sealed packaging that keeps the specific character hidden until opened.
The physical item comes equipped with 223’s NFC technology, which allows users to unlock digital perks. Buyers will receive an NFT proof-of-collectible, a digital trading card on the Base Network, and access to future digital interactions. “For lifestyle character brands, plush is the emotional centerpiece… It’s often the first product that gets passed down, displayed, or treasured, so it holds significant meaning and is key to start with,” said 223 founder Cole Gernum.
Other NFT collections, such as Walmart-bringing-NFTs-mainstream”>Pudgy Penguins, have recently launched their own physical toy lines, some earning more than $10 million in sales within a year. Timperley said, “Pudgy Penguins has been a trailblazer in this space, proving what’s possible when you combine strong IP with smart distribution.”
Chimpers plush keychains will be priced affordably and available for both crypto and fiat payments. Holders of Chimpers NFTs will have guaranteed access to the presale. “This first online release is one of many small, but intentional moves that will drive long-term discovery and growth for Chimpers,” Timperley said.
The partnership between Chimpers and 223 marks the start of a broader strategy to reach new fans and increase brand engagement.
